Description
Born and raised in a rural Hiroshima town, Haruto Kirishima once encountered a lost Yuzuki Eba during a childhood summer festival, comforting her and suggesting she seek him if troubled again—though he later forgot this meeting. Entering middle school, he developed an unspoken affection for classmate Nanami Kanzaki that persisted into high school. Standing 175 cm with a normal build, brown hair, and dark-blue eyes, he was initially reserved and shy yet stubborn in affection, displaying kindness and responsibility while often averting his gaze in intimate or misunderstood situations. His cooking skills, refined through family meals and part-time restaurant work, led him to join the school cooking club—partly hoping Nanami would join.

When Yuzuki moved from Tokyo to live with his family, Haruto reacted with irritation and failed to recognize her initially. Despite this, he grew protective, forming a close friendship. Yuzuki helped him become more outgoing, enabling his confession to Nanami, who later rejected him after he repeatedly prioritized Yuzuki’s needs over their plans—including missing a date to assist Yuzuki with Tokyo family issues. Nanami confirmed her rejection stemmed from Haruto’s unresolved feelings for Yuzuki. After Yuzuki returned to Tokyo, Haruto confessed his love, starting a long-distance relationship that faltered when she abruptly cut contact. Discovering a farewell letter in her gift—indicating she had a new boyfriend—Haruto fell into deep depression. Suspecting trouble, he transferred to a Tokyo high school, learning Yuzuki dated Kyousuke Kazama, who had under a year to live due to terminal illness. Haruto declared "war" on Kazama for Yuzuki’s affections, preferring open competition over secret resentment. Kazama initially survived risky surgery but died shortly after from postoperative stress.

Following Kazama’s funeral, Haruto and Yuzuki parted permanently. Months later, Haruto accepted a confession from neighbor and friend Asuka Mishima after her ultimatum. They dated for a year and a half until repeated chance encounters with Yuzuki rekindled Haruto’s feelings. Acknowledging this to Asuka caused their breakup and cost him several friendships. Haruto and Yuzuki reconciled, eventually cohabiting in Tokyo despite her father’s initial opposition. During college, they balanced part-time jobs and new acquaintances, strengthening their bond. Post-graduation, career assignments separated them: Haruto worked in Kōchi while Yuzuki taught in Tokyo. Long-distance strain led to their breakup after Yuzuki collapsed from overwork. Years later, Haruto developed the successful beverage "Yuzu no Hana" and transferred back to Tokyo, reuniting with Yuzuki under cherry blossoms as promised. They married, had a son named Daiki, and opened Kirishima Restaurant. A decade later, they returned to Hiroshima, where Haruto ran the restaurant with Yuzuki assisting during school breaks.
